Output 65909e3277527df4d1d9a5dc7534ca86fc079dcbba7ed697c64a399874277b89:1

value
5587474
script pubkey
OP_0 OP_PUSHBYTES_20 b62cd37dfb754e572e6d27be9c77533009105b8c
address
bc1qkckdxl0mw489wtndy7lfca6nxqy3qkuvjcfr8d
transaction
65909e3277527df4d1d9a5dc7534ca86fc079dcbba7ed697c64a399874277b89
confirmations
170478
spent
true